My Story

19 Jun 2026

I never had the honor to meet Liam but, I know his story through his mom and dad. I worked with and became friends with his dad soon after Liam passed away in 2005. What hit me then and stays with me to this day is the way Kevin spoke of the battle Liam fought and how positive he stayed and how much joy he brought.

Kevin and Andrea, thank you for letting me share his story!

Please read more about Liam below.

Liam was always the typical little boy who loved running, playing, laughing and being silly. He had a smile that would melt your heart and a laugh that was contagious. He continued to be a "normal", beautiful boy throughout his entire battle with neuroblastoma, even with his "tubies" and yucky medicines he had to take. He amazed us all with his strength, courage, patience and trust and he still made us all laugh! He remained a "normal" boy, probably because he didn't have the fear that we adults owned. Liam never owned the adult concept of feeling sorry for himself and taught many adults life lessons that we will never, ever forget.

Liam loved dinosaurs from the time he could walk...he was sure he would be a paleontologist and discover more bones! He also loved Power Rangers, monster trucks, Star Wars, baseball, and every color of the rainbow... and he loved blue Gatorade, lemonade, and pretzels! He was our "Superman" and he still is! Liam was diagnosed with Neuroblastoma when he was 3 1/2 years old and after battling this disease for 20 months... he died at home at age 5 1/2... leaving behind his little sister, Alli … Liam's 5 incredible years here on earth and we will use his passion for life to help others and to spread awareness about these horrible things that happen to our children. Clearly, "Childhood Cancer Should be Extinct!"

HOPE FAITH COURAGE... Kevin, Andrea and Alli Kane
